Abstract

The invention discloses a hand-held UV blue light nail beautifying box. The hand-held UV blue light nail beautifying box comprises a box body. The upper end face of the box body is an arc face. The lower end face of the box body is a rectangular flat face. The lower end face is provided with an opening where four fingers can be inserted simultaneously. An LED light-emitting source is arranged on one side face inside the opening. Finger touch spots are arranged on the other side face opposite to the side face with the LED light-emitting source. A pressure sensor is arranged on each finger touch spot. An intelligent processing chip is arranged in the box body. The intelligent processing chip is connected with the LED light-emitting source. The intelligent processing chip is further and electrically connected with the pressure sensors on the finger touch spots. A built-in battery is further arranged in the box body. The build-in battery is connected with the intelligent processing chip and further and electrically connected with a charging port formed in the side face of the box body. The hand-held UV blue light nail beautifying box has the advantages of being small in size, convenient to use and low in energy consumption.

Description

technical field [0001] The invention relates to the field of improvement of manicure equipment, in particular to a handheld UV blu-ray manicure box. Background technique [0002] Manicure has become one of the long-term cares for women in today's society. However, the lighting equipment used to dry nail polish is difficult to control the light intensity and irradiation time, so it is easy to cause damage to the skin of women's hands. When using this lighting equipment, it must be operated by experienced professionals, even if it still affects the hand skin due to the error of human judgment. [0003] The existing nail art drying equipment is relatively large in size and must be placed on a stable desktop to work, which is not flexible enough and not very convenient to use. During the drying operation, it is necessary to open the finger into the opening of the nail drying equipment, and the opening is facing the human body.
